Biography
Terry Thieme proudly served his country in the United States Marine Corps. His military career included both domestic and international assignments, during which he received several meritorious promotions. He was honorably discharged as a Sergeant.
Following his military service, Terry dedicated himself to public service by joining law enforcement. He served in various capacities in several communities, including the Town of Beloit, City of Jefferson, and the City of Waukesha. During his 19-year tenure with the Waukesha Police Department, he held diverse roles, including Field Training Officer, Bicycle Officer, School Resource Officer, and member of the Tactical Team.
Terry pursued his education concurrently with his career, earning an Associate Degree in Police Science from Waukesha County Technical College and a Bachelor of Science degree from Mount Senario College. After retiring from law enforcement in 2007, he served on the Waukesha Common Council, representing Aldermanic District 1, until 2019.
Currently, Terry serves as a Coordinator in Credit Card Operations at Kohl's, Inc. in Menomonee Falls, where he continues to apply his dedication and leadership skills. He also serves on the board of the Kohl's Veterans and Military Business Resource Group, advocating for the needs of veterans and military personnel within the company.
Terry and his wife, Karen, are proud parents of three children and enjoy spending time with their five grandchildren.
